Job Role:
We are seeking a reliable and hardworking Concrete and Block Demounter to join our production team. The successful candidate will be responsible for safely removing, handling, stacking, and preparing concrete products and blocks after production.
Key Responsibilities
- Safely demount, remove, and handle concrete blocks and related products from moulds, production lines, pallets, and production areas.
- Stack, organise, and prepare finished products for curing, storage, loading, or dispatch.
- Inspect finished products for defects, damage, or quality issues and report concerns to the supervisor.
- Operate tools and equipment safely when trained and authorised.
- Clean and maintain moulds, equipment, and production areas to a high standard.
- Follow all health and safety procedures, including the use of PPE, manual handling requirements, and reporting of incidents, near misses, defects, and unsafe conditions.
- Work closely with supervisors and colleagues to achieve daily production targets.
- Assist with general production, yard, and housekeeping duties as required.
- Carry out any other reasonable duties as requested by management.
